Gates of Ionian Village closed, but program and content is wide open

Although the COVID-19 pandemic has forced the cancellation of the traditional beloved Ionian Village Summer 2020 program, the Administration team is still hard at work.  The Office of Ionian Village has already begun, and will continue, to provide ministry virtually.  From Vespers to devotional sessions, many opportunities exist for the youth of our Archdiocese, parish youth ministers, and parents to connect with our amazing life-transforming ministry.

The summer kicked off with a historic meeting of several former Directors of Ionian Village.  Fr. Gary Kyriacou, the current Director of Ionian Village, met with Fr. Costas Sitaras, Michael Pappas, and Fr. Evagoras Constantinides on Wednesday, May 20, 2020.  The former Directors shared insights, traditions, and the influence that Ionian Village provided to thousands over the years.  The Directors will continue to meet on a somewhat regular basis to discuss Alumni engagement and opportunities to help make Ionian Village affordable and accessible to as many youth of our Archdiocese as possible.

Every evening at Ionian Village begins with Vespers.  The Office of Ionian Village hosts this service online weekly and will continue through the summer.  Every Thursday evening at 8:30 PM ET, former campers, staff, directors, medical staff, clergy and their family members gather on Zoom to pray.  The Office of Ionian Village has creatively outlined the best way to gather a large group to chant and read assigned parts by members participating from all over the country.

While many of our Greek-American teenagers may not walk through the gates of Ionian Village this summer, IV is still working to provide an opportunity to deepen the faith and appreciation for our shared faith and Greek culture online this summer. The COVID-19 pandemic has shut down many business and programs, but nothing will keep the Office of Ionian Village from making the love of Christ and His Church relevant for the youth of our Archdiocese.
